**Insights from iPhone Game Developers who consistently find
Success on the App Store**
Have you ever wondered about iPhone game development or even just
how to create an app?
What separates the world's most successful iOS game developers
from the vast majority of App Store failures?
There are currently more than 700,000 apps on the App Store. It's
only a matter of time before the number of apps skyrocket past the
million mark.
That's a lot of apps out there and the competition for downloads is
brutal.
Learn Tips and Tricks from Best Selling iPhone Game Developers
Shane Lee spoke to hundreds of iPhone app developers and curated a
selection of the most intriguing success stories to find out how
they accomplished their goals. These are the developers behind
award winning games such as Canabalt, Bumpy Road, Super Crate Box,
Hunters, Spider: The Secret of Bryce Mansion and many more.
While this book focuses on mobile game developers that have
published iOS games, the lessons here are applicable to other
platforms such as Blackberry and Android.
You'll learn:
- Why Canabalt creator Adam Saltsman believes in cultivating
friendships with game journalists
- Why localizing Squids in French and German led to an increase in
sales for The Game Bakers
- How Hunters creator Ben Murch's persistance and tenacity finally
landed their game a feature in a popular gaming website
- Why Bumpy Road creator Simon Flesser emphasizes the use of
making video trailers to promote his games
- What Vlambeer Studios did when their game, Radical Fishing got
ripped off
If you're interested in mobile game development, game creation,
entrepreneurship or even just how to develop an iPhone application,
then this book will give you a realistic look into what it takes to
become a success.
